    Abstract:

    The systematically mineralogical study of a swelling chlorite found from Wuding, Yunnan, is reported. The data of form, physical property, chemical analysis, X-ray powder diffraction, thermal analysis, infrared spectrum, electron microscope and changes of the mineral after heating are described in this paper. The untreated chlorite has a 14.68A of d(001)which changs to 16.13A when treating with ethylene glycol and to 14.30A after heating to 550℃(2hrs). Heated above 900t it has been changed into bronzite-hypersthene. The chemi- cal analyses gave, SiO2 34.71,A1203 12.10,Fe203 4.59,Fe0 7.48, Ca0 0.61, Mg0 23.60, H20+10.34 and H20-5.35%·The swelling chlorite is fibrous. In this paper data of X-ray diffraction as well as infrared spectrum patterns while heated to 330 ℃,550℃.620℃ 820℃. 900℃,1000℃ and 1100℃are recorded.
